【技术实现步骤摘要】
【国外来华专利技术】用于增强型比特币钱包的计算机实现的系统和方法
本专利技术主要涉及分布式账本(区块链)技术,且更具体地,涉及使用此类技术执行或触发计算机实现的过程。本专利技术还涉及数字钱包技术和智能合约,以及通过加密导向的事件执行的过程的安全性。
技术介绍
在本文中,我们使用术语“区块链”来涵盖所有形式的电子的、基于计算机的分布式账本。这些电子的、基于计算机的分布式账本包括但不限于区块链和交易链技术、许可及未经许可的账本、共享账本及其变型。虽然已经提出并开发了其他区块链实施方案,但是区块链技术最广为人知的应用是比特币账本。尽管出于方便和说明的目的,本文中涉及的是比特币,但应当指出的是,本专利技术不限于与比特币区块链一起使用,其他的区块链实施方式和协议也落入本专利技术的范围内。术语“比特币”可以包括比特币区块链的任何分支、版本或变体。根据上下文,术语“用户”在本文中可以指人员或基于处理器的资源。区块链是一种点对点的电子账本,该账本被实现为基于计算机的去中心化的分布式系统,该系统由区块组成,而区块又由交易组成。每个交易都是对区块链系统中参 ...
【技术保护点】
1.一种由区块链实现的系统,包括:/n数字钱包;和/n过程执行组件,所述过程执行组件嵌入在所述数字钱包内、与所述数字钱包相关联或用于与所述数字钱包交互,并且用于执行和/或发起至少一个过程,以响应和区块链交易相关联的脚本中提供的至少一个触发器;/n其中,所述过程执行组件是和/或包括解释器,所述解释器用于将由所述触发器提供或表示的编码指令转换成可执行逻辑。/n
【技术特征摘要】
【国外来华专利技术】20171130 GB 1719947.2;20171130 IB PCT/IB2017/057541.一种由区块链实现的系统,包括:
数字钱包;和
过程执行组件,所述过程执行组件嵌入在所述数字钱包内、与所述数字钱包相关联或用于与所述数字钱包交互,并且用于执行和/或发起至少一个过程,以响应和区块链交易相关联的脚本中提供的至少一个触发器;
其中,所述过程执行组件是和/或包括解释器,所述解释器用于将由所述触发器提供或表示的编码指令转换成可执行逻辑。
2.根据权利要求1所述的系统,其中:
所述钱包是加密货币钱包。
3.根据权利要求1或2所述的系统,其中:
所述至少一个触发器包括一个或多个代码、标志、指令和/或参数。
4.根据前述任意一项权利要求所述的系统,其中:
所述至少一个触发器使信号发送到所述钱包之外的目的地。
5.根据前述任意一项权利要求所述的系统,其中:
所述过程是预定的,并且对于所述过程执行组件和/或钱包是已知的。
6.根据前述任意一项权利要求所述的系统,其中:
所述过程由所述脚本确定或在所述脚本内指定,优选地,其中所述过程执行组件用于将所述脚本中的一个或多个项目转换或解释为可执行逻辑。
7.根据前述任意一项权利要求所述的系统,其中:
所述至少一个触发器和/或所述至少一个过程是根据合约选择或确定的,优选地,其中所述合约为智能合约。
8.根据前述任意一项权利要求所述的系统,其中:
所述至少一个触发器在所述脚本提供的元数据内提供或由所述脚本提供的元数据提供。
9.根据前述任意一项权利要求所述的系统,其中:
所述脚本与所述区块链交易的输出相关联,并且花费输出使得将令牌和/或部分货币转移给区块链上的接收者。
10.根据前述任意一项权利要求所述的系统,其中:
所述系统还包括多个数字钱包和/或过程执行组件。
11.一种由区块链实现的方法,所述方法包括以下步骤:
提供过程执行组件,所述过程执行组件嵌入在数字或加密货币钱包中、与数字或加密货币钱包相关联或用于与数字或加密货币钱包进行交互,并且用于执行至少一个过程,以响应至少一个触发器,所述至少一个触发器与区块链交易...
【专利技术属性】
技术研发人员:克雷格·史蒂文·赖特,
申请(专利权)人:区块链控股有限公司,
类型:发明
国别省市:安提瓜和巴布达;AG
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。